Deadline: 30-Nov-22

Save Our Seas Foundation (SOSF) is delighted to introduce its Ocean Storytelling Writing Grant as the latest development in their continued drive to support a new generation of ocean storytellers who can convey conservation crises with precision and empathy and kindle the kind of wonder that nudges us all closer to the sea.

This writing category builds on the legacy of their previous photography grants and is dedicated to supporting a diverse generation of emerging conservation storytellers. While they don’t expect all applicants to be writers with a marine focus, they are specifically looking for writers who can tell conservation stories about the ocean. Whether they describe marine animals themselves, or fisheries, or the communities whose lives are intertwined with the life of the sea, a writer’s words can inform, transport, enchant, endear and persuade.

Successful grantees will receive a paid assignment to cover a conservation story under the direct mentorship of the Storytelling Grant team. They particularly wish to support early career and emerging storytellers and aim to encourage new voices with fresh perspectives and writing approaches, so although applicants must be already committed to writing, they should have no more than five years of professional experience in any writing-related discipline. They encourage women and applicants from underrepresented communities to apply for this opportunity. Applications will be accepted both directly via open call and through nomination.

Award Information

Three winners will be selected for the grant.
